.vf-formula{opacity:var(--vf-formula-show,0);transform:translateY(calc((1 - var(--vf-formula-show,0)) * 12px));pointer-events:none;flex-direction:column;justify-content:center;align-items:flex-start;transition:opacity 80ms linear,transform .12s linear;display:flex;position:absolute;inset:0}.vf-formula__eyebrow{color:var(--soft-blue);margin-bottom:16px}.vf-formula__title{font-family:var(--sans);letter-spacing:-.02em;color:var(--ink);max-width:14ch;margin:0 0 22px;font-size:clamp(1.8rem,3.4vw,2.6rem);font-weight:700;line-height:1.05}.vf-formula__title em{font-family:inherit;font-style:normal;font-weight:inherit;color:inherit;letter-spacing:inherit}.vf-formula__list{flex-direction:column;gap:14px;max-width:42ch;margin:0 0 22px;padding:0;list-style:none;display:flex}.vf-formula__item{opacity:var(--vf-formula-show,0);transform:translateY(calc((1 - var(--vf-formula-show,0)) * 6px));transition:opacity .24s,transform .24s;transition-delay:calc(var(--i,0) * 80ms)}.vf-formula__name{color:var(--ink);letter-spacing:-.01em;margin-bottom:2px;font-size:1rem;font-weight:700}.vf-formula__desc{color:var(--body);font-size:.93rem;line-height:1.5}.vf-formula__link{background:var(--ink);color:#fff;font-family:var(--sans);letter-spacing:-.005em;opacity:var(--vf-formula-show,0);transform:translateY(calc((1 - var(--vf-formula-show,0)) * 6px));pointer-events:auto;border:0;border-radius:999px;align-items:center;gap:10px;margin-top:6px;padding:16px 30px;font-size:1.05rem;font-weight:700;text-decoration:none;transition:opacity .24s .38s,transform .24s .38s,background-color .18s .38s,box-shadow .18s .38s,color .18s .38s;display:inline-flex;box-shadow:0 2px #0d25450f,0 14px 28px -10px #0d254552}.vf-formula__link:hover,.vf-formula__link:focus-visible{background:var(--soft-blue);color:#fff;border-bottom:0;outline:none;box-shadow:0 2px #3b6dac14,0 16px 32px -10px #3b6dac6b}.vf-formula__link span[aria-hidden]{font-size:1.15rem;transition:transform .22s;display:inline-flex;transform:translateY(-1px)}.vf-formula__link:hover span[aria-hidden]{transform:translate(3px,-1px)}@media (max-width:899px){.vf-formula__link{align-self:flex-start;gap:8px;width:auto;padding:11px 20px;font-size:.86rem}.vf-formula__link span[aria-hidden]{font-size:1rem}}.story--vf .story__copy{position:relative}.story--vf .story__copy-orig{opacity:var(--vf-copy-fade,1);transform:translateY(calc((1 - var(--vf-copy-fade,1)) * -8px));transition:opacity 80ms linear,transform .12s linear}@media (max-width:899px){.vf-formula{justify-content:flex-start;padding:clamp(40px,9vh,80px) clamp(20px,5vw,32px) 0}.vf-formula__title{max-width:none;margin-bottom:12px;font-size:clamp(1.3rem,5.4vw,1.7rem)}.vf-formula__list{gap:10px;max-width:50ch;margin-bottom:12px}.vf-formula__item:nth-child(2),.vf-formula__item:nth-child(3){display:none}.vf-formula__name{margin-bottom:2px;font-size:.9rem}.vf-formula__desc{font-size:.82rem;line-height:1.42}.vf-formula__eyebrow{margin-bottom:8px;font-size:.68rem}}@media (max-width:480px){.vf-formula__list{gap:8px}.vf-formula__desc{font-size:.8rem;line-height:1.4}.vf-formula__title{margin-bottom:10px;font-size:1.3rem}}@media (prefers-reduced-motion:reduce){.vf-formula,.vf-formula__item,.vf-formula__link,.story--vf .story__copy-orig{transition:none!important}}
